Specifications Comparison: Hyundai Elantra vs. Chevrolet Avalanche

Model Year20142012
ModelElantraAvalanche
Body4dr Sedan4dr SUT
Wheelbase106.3 in130.0 in
Length179.1 in221.3 in
Width69.9 in79.1 in
Height56.5 in76.6 in
Curb Weight2,923 lb.5,840 lb.
Fuel Capacity12.8 gal.31.0 gal.
Row 1 Headroom40.0 in41.1 in
Row 1 Shoulder Room55.9 in65.3 in
Row 1 Hip Room53.5 in64.4 in
Row 1 Legroom43.6 in41.3 in
Row 2 Headroom37.1 in40.0 in
Row 2 Shoulder Room54.8 in65.2 in
Row 2 Hip Room52.7 in62.3 in
Row 2 Legroom33.1 in39.1 in
Cargo Volume,
Minimum
14.8 ft345.5 ft3
Cargo Volume,
Maximum
14.8101.1 ft3
